WebWhy does the Earth have layers? Shortly after earth formed, the decay of radioactive elements combined with heat released by colliding particles, produced some melting of the interior. An ice core. Credit: NASA's Goddard Space Flight Center/Ludovic Brucker. We know what Earth's past climate was like by studying things that have been around for a long time. ... The layers in an ice core are frozen solid. These layers of ice give clues about every year of Earth's history ...

WebNov 27, 2024 · There are four main layers to Earth: crust, mantle, outer core and inner core, along with transition zones between these layers.
